Christa White
Discovery Children’s Museum
Las Vegas

1. What makes your store unique?
The store at Discovery Children’s Museum caters to everyone. I have carefully selected our entire inventory and made sure it pertains to our exhibits, is educational and is priced to sell to families of all backgrounds. My store offers books for new readers, educational help books, even guides for new grandparents!

2. What is your retail background?
I have worked in retail for 10 years in many positions, from sales associate to stock management, store management, area merchandiser and buyer.

3. What is the most popular product you sell?
This is always a hard question to answer because it depends on who is shopping. If it is a 4-year-old boy, it’s our wide selection of die-cast planes. An 8-year-old girl goes straight for the craft kits, but the most popular is our plush snakes and tumble stones.

4. What are your top three retail tips?
Know your product and how it relates to your museum, be well stocked and offer exuberant displays both in store and windows.
